In Australia, on average, one man dies as a result of domestic violence every 10 days. This figure is easily verified. Read Table 10 in the document Australian Homicide Report 2010-2011 to 2011-2012: National Homicide Monitoring Program report.[1] This report covers the 2010-2011 & 2011-2012 Australian financial years, specifically from July 31, 2010 to June 30, 2012 inclusive.
